Profile of 2022-23 Financial Aid
Profile of 2022-23 Financial Aid
expand icon
Freshman
Financial Aid Applicants
1,004 (91.7%) of freshmen
Found to Have Financial Need
756 (75.3%) of applicants
Received Financial Aid
756 (100.0%) of applicants with financial need
Need Fully Met
252 (33.3%) of aid recipients
Average Percent of Need Met
82%
Average Award
$34,539
Need-Based Gift
Received by 742 (98.1%) of aid recipients, average amount $27,585
Need-Based Self-Help
Received by 491 (64.9%) of aid recipients, average amount $4,696
Merit-Based Gift
Received by 193 (25.5%) of aid recipients
300 (27.4%) of freshmen had no financial need and received merit aid, average amount $19,727
All Undergraduates
Financial Aid Applicants
3,846 (80.0%) of undergraduates
Found to Have Financial Need
3,017 (78.5%) of applicants
Received Financial Aid
3,012 (99.8%) of applicants with financial need
Need Fully Met
892 (29.6%) of aid recipients
Average Percent of Need Met
78%
Average Award
$33,013
Need-Based Gift
Received by 2,912 (96.7%) of aid recipients, average amount $25,794
Need-Based Self-Help
Received by 2,093 (69.5%) of aid recipients, average amount $5,746
Merit-Based Gift
Received by 629 (20.9%) of aid recipients
1,448 (30.1%) of undergraduates had no financial need and received merit aid, average amount $17,461
All Undergraduates
2018 Graduates Who Took Out Loans
65%
Average Indebtedness of 2018 Graduates
$42,679
